I continue to stay in the quarters given to me at HQ, which makes it easy to attend my therapy appointments at the Facility. Our townhouse feels different with Barbi missing. I don’t like spending time there when she’s not there. Zeb says the Guardians are hard at work, and I feel it. There’s tension and energy swirling in the air as everyone works desperately to find Alec and Barbi.

I feel it too, and better understand the worry Carmen and Rosalie felt when I went missing. I understand what Zeb felt when Dean Alder shoved me into the car and left him for dead, but I have faith in the Guardians. They’ll find Barbi. Alec too.

Until then, I do the work to manage my trauma, and secretly plan how to beat Zeb at his own game.

He doesn’t know it, but there’s no way I’m losing our bet. With a smile on my face, I get to work, and when I come home, I know there will be a Guardian in my bed who loves me more than life itself.

And I love him just as much.

We’ve been through hell, but I look to the future with renewed hope, excited for whatever comes next. With Zeb by my side, whatever that will be is going to be wonderful.

For the secondtime in my life, I walk away from everything I know and venture into the unknown.

After a harrowing escape, and enduring several agonizing hours wedged into a cramped middle seat in the back of economy, I find myself in another unfamiliar place, with no name, and utterly clueless about what comes next.

The moment I disembark the plane, the pandemonium of San Francisco’s bustling airport amplifies my already frazzled nerves.

I close my eyes, regulate my breath, and steel myself to face what comes next.

I’m here.

I’m alive.

That’s all that matters.

It’s time to start life number three—maybe this time, I really will disappear from those who want me dead. I scan the crowd, looking for my newest protector.

The airport teems with the hustle and bustle of hundreds of lives, if not thousands. People dart around me in all directions. Public announcements blare over the public address system, people shout, kids wail, tired parents attempt to navigate the chaos without losing a bag, a child, or a spouse. Occasionally, a runner sprints by frantic to make their flight. Harried gate agents strive to keep the crowd in check while placating disgruntled passengers with unwavering smiles.

The sheer energy of the place is overwhelming. My constant companion, anxiety, spikes my heart rate, tightens my chest, and turns my palms into a sweaty mess.

After the Witness Protection Program failed to safeguard my new identity, another organization took over my protection. Although I’m not sure what to think about the Guardian Hostage Rescue Specialists, they’re the ones who stepped up to protect me. It’s a daunting name, but I’m neither a hostage, nor do I need rescuing. What I require is protection from men who want me dead.
